Oil tanks and lubrication systems hold viscous, sticky media that clog mechanical floats and cause false alarms. This IP68 capacitive level sensor uses a 316L stainless steel body and a food-grade PEEK conical probe with no moving parts — so there is nothing to clog, jam or wear out. Fully submersible and quick-connected via aviation plug, it delivers reliable liquid detection for oil tanks, lubrication systems and high-viscosity fluids.
The sensor detects liquid presence by measuring the change in capacitance when the probe is covered by the medium. Because it has no moving parts, sticky oil and viscous liquids cannot jam it. The NPN/PNP dual output drives a PLC or relay directly, and the LED indicates power (red) and output (green) status. The 316L housing and PEEK probe provide corrosion resistance and compatibility with oil and food-grade contact.

Q: What is a capacitive level sensor?
A capacitive level sensor detects liquid by measuring the capacitance change when its probe contacts the medium. Unlike mechanical float switches, it has no moving parts, so viscous and sticky liquids like oil cannot clog or jam it, giving reliable, maintenance-free level detection.
Q: Why is it IP68 rated?
IP68 means the sensor is fully submersible and protected against continuous immersion in water. This makes it suitable for installation inside tanks and sumps where the sensor body may be submerged in the liquid.
Q: What materials are used?
The housing is 316L stainless steel for corrosion resistance, and the probe is food-grade PEEK — a strong, chemically resistant polymer safe for oil and food contact. This material combination suits oil tanks and lubrication systems.
Q: Does it have moving parts?
No. The sensor has no moving parts, which is its key advantage. In viscous or sticky media such as oil and lubricants, mechanical floats and rods tend to clog and fail, whereas a capacitive sensor operates reliably without any mechanical motion.
Q: What output does it provide?
It provides NPN and PNP dual output, so it can interface with both sinking and sourcing PLC inputs and drive relays directly. The LED display shows power (red) and output (green) status for easy commissioning.
